Foreword
This document was drafted in accordance with the rules provided in GB/T 1.1-2020 Directives
for Standardization - Part 1.Rules for the Structure and Drafting of Standardizing Documents.
This document serves as a replacement for QC/T 242-2014 Static Unbalance Requirements and
Test Methods of Vehicle Wheels. In comparison with QC/T 242-2014, apart from structural
adjustments and editorial modifications, the main technical changes are as follows.
a) The terms and definitions are modified (see Chapter 3; Chapter 3 of Version 2014);
b) The requirements for valve configuration for the test of light alloy wheels are
modified (see Chapter 4; Chapter 4 of Version 2014);
c) The requirements for the test equipment are added (see Chapter 5);
d) The requirements for the amount of static unbalance of light alloy wheels on
commercial vehicles are modified (see Chapter 6; Chapter 5 of Version 2014);
e) The test methods are modified (see Chapter 7; Chapter 6 of Version 2014).

1 Scope
This document specifies the requirements and test methods for the static unbalance of vehicle
wheels.
This document is applicable to the determination of static unbalance of vehicle wheels.

3 Terms and Definitions
The terms and definitions defined in GB/T 2933 and GB/T 6444, and the following are
applicable to this document.
3.1 mass eccentricity
The distance from the center of mass of the wheel to the centerline of the wheel.
3.2 amount of static unbalance
The product of the wheel mass multiplied by the mass eccentricity (3.1).
3.5 angle of static unbalance
The circumferential angle between the center of mass of the static unbalance mass (3.4) and the
specified datum point.

7 Test Methods
7.1 In accordance with the wheel model, enter the necessary parameters. If necessary, install
the valve (equivalent replacement or set the automatic compensation value of the equipment).
7.2 Install the wheels and start the balancing machine, so as to test the amount of static
unbalance (or static unbalance mass) and the angle of static unbalance of the wheels.
